PPRL Returns after Five Year Hiatus! Winter Heat is coming in January!

I am happy to announce that the decision has been made to bring back the premier racing league that revitalized virtual monster truck racing. The Past Present Racing league was originally founded and ran over eleven years ago and grew in a short time frame to exceptional levels of competitiveness among drivers, while providing a fun relaxed atmosphere to all who competed. PPRL helped elevate many to new heights in MTM2 from becoming better drivers, officials and content makers to the creation of many spin-off leagues hoping to obtain the same levels of success. PPRL also helped spawn the ideology of special events such as Fall Madness, Christmas Mayhem and the Classic Clash that grew from being a large gathering to an entire feature length event spawning multiple days. Without a doubt in many minds PPRL was the best league MTM2 had seen.

While this level of success was rather unexpected it also came over the course of nearly half a decade. At this point and time here is a breakdown of what I am exploring for the Winter Heat Series. Feel free to discuss below until a forum discussion area is created.

5 Week Schedule, Featuring Classic Racing and Modern Racing / Freestyle. Starting the first week of January.

Looking to compete on either Monday or Tuesday Nights depending on my current work schedule. This will allow many who run larger leagues on the weekend to not be interfered with.

Event Chat starting at 7:00PM EST on AIM and TeamSpeak with qualifying session beginning at 7:30PM EST and running until 8:30 PM EST. Racing to follow at 8:45 PM EST and Freestyle to start at 9:30 PM EST. 

12 Truck Racing Bracket. Featuring Fast Loser advancing into quarter final round on either side of the bracket. All drivers must qualify in order to be eligible to freestyle.

Freestyle will consist of a unrealistic mind set; but will be limited to certain parameters such as one roll save and a 30 second grace period.  

Classic Racing is subject to debate by those who race here. I would like to limit the signups to just using John Browns Leaf Sprung trucks as they're standalone. I realize this doesn't promote the greatest aspect of different trucks but I am more focused on the racing aspect itself for now. Is this an obtainable option?

Tracks will feature MTM2 remakes, RoR favorites and hopefully for the final event a new track.
